How to make Minecraft fireworks



You'll need at least one piece of paper and a piece of gunpowder to make an explosive rocket. To boost the speed of the rocket's flight you can add two gunpowders. This will determine how high the rocket will fly.



However, if you want those beautiful explosion effects you'll need to include an explosion star. The creation of the firework star is the point where you get to customise the firework's explosion. Combine gunpowder and up to eight dyes to create a fireworks star. To create a twinkle effect or a trail effect after an explosion, add glowstone dust or diamond. These effects can be added to the star.



You can also alter the shape of the fireworks explosion. Adding a fire charge will produce a massive circular explosion; a gold nugget can create a star-shaped explosion and a head of any kind will create an explosion that resembles the form of a creeper's face and a feather will produce an explosion with a burst shape. Only one of these shape modifiers is allowed in the firework star.



Once you've created your star You can add a 'fade-to-colour' effect by mixing any dye with it.



How to create an Minecraft firework display



Once you've been given your fireworks, you could be thinking of how to get them going to create the best show. You can use a firework to illuminate a block. If you're looking for precision and let the fireworks go off from a safe distance then you'll need to place your fireworks in dispensers. Redstone can activate the fireworks. They will shoot in the direction they're fired, however you can create diagonal paths by firing them through flowing water. Using Minecraft fireworks with Elytra



Elytra allows you to fly through fireworks. This is a fantastic method to propel yourself through the air. The quantity of gunpowder used in rocket creation will affect the duration of the boost.



It is crucial to leave out the firework star when crafting fireworks to be used for this purpose, since the explosion effects they produce will damage you. Ouch. If you don't mix your rockets up, you'll be able to fly through the sky, exploring the vast areas of your Minecraft seed. Make sure you have enough fireworks to last your return trip.
